Swagat Indian Restaurant has been serving authentic Indian cuisine to the Chelsea crowd for years. Their succulent dishes and enticing aromas have made Swagat an established neighborhood favorite.
Read more
Try the rich Chicken Tikka Masala with some hot, fluffy naan. The Lamb Saag is creamy and served with fresh spinach. The vindaloo dishes are spicy and delicious. The prices are low and the servings are huge. Drop on by and enjoy the friendly service or simply order in. Rest assured that you will love Swagat.

Chicken Samosa—Minced chicken wrapped in a crispy patty
Aloo Gobhi—Potatoes and cauliflower cooked with spices
Chicken Tikka Masala—Boneless chicken cooked in tandoor, then tossed in creamy tomato sauce
Lamb Saag—Lamb cooked with spinach
Tandoori Chicken—Chicken marinated in tandoori sauce and cooked in a clay oven
Garlic Naan—Bread stuffed with garlic
